EDWARD LAPPEN
Crittenton Women’s Union Board Member Edward Lappen died suddenly on December 31st, a sad loss that will be profoundly felt by the CWU staff and board. Ed brought deep compassion and determined commitment to helping women and their families overcome poverty and achieve the American dream.
As a model business leader for 30 years, he recognized the critical importance of creating opportunities for growth and advancement. His keen support of CWU’s Woman to Woman and Career Family Opportunity programs reflected his belief in providing people with the skills and knowledge necessary to succeed.
A CWU Board Member since 2009, Ed contributed his leadership and experience to the CWU Finance Committee. Ed was the chief executive officer of Lappen Auto Supply in Stoughton, Mass. A resident of Cohasset, Mass., Ed served as vice chair of the Cohasset Advisory Committee and was a member of the Democratic Town Committee. He was an adviser for the Appalachia Service Project and a team captain for the American Cancer Society Relay for Life. He received his B.A. from Clark University and his J.D. from Suffolk University.
We at CWU extend our heartfelt sympathy to Ed’s wife Helene, his children, Mia and Ross, his parents Joe and Shirley, and all his extended family and friends. His infectious humor, kindness, and wisdom will be missed for years to come.
